import type { McpServer } from "@modelcontextprotocol/sdk/server/mcp.js";
import crypto from "node:crypto";
import { z } from "zod";
import { BaseTools } from "./base";
import * as database from "../utils/database";
export class TransactionTools extends BaseTools {
transactions: Map<string, any> = new Map();
static create(server: McpServer) {
const tools = new TransactionTools();
server.tool(
"start-transaction",
"Start a new transaction",
tools.startTransaction.bind(tools)
);
server.tool(
"commit-transaction",
"Commit a transaction",
{ transactionId: z.string().describe("The ID of the transaction to commit.") },
tools.commitTransaction.bind(tools),
);
server.tool(
"rollback-transaction",
"Rollback a transaction",
{ transactionId: z.string().describe("The ID of the transaction to rollback.") },
tools.rollbackTransaction.bind(tools),
);
return tools;
}
async startTransaction() {
const transactionId = crypto.randomUUID();
const transaction = await database.startTransaction();
this.transactions.set(transactionId, transaction);
return this.toResult(`Transaction started with ID: ${transactionId}. You can use this ID to commit or rollback the transaction later.`);
}
async commitTransaction({ transactionId }: { transactionId: string }) {
const transaction = this.transactions.get(transactionId);
if (!transaction) {
throw new Error(`Transaction with ID ${transactionId} not found.`);
}
await transaction.commit();
this.transactions.delete(transactionId);
return this.toResult(`Transaction with ID ${transactionId} committed successfully.`);
}
async rollbackTransaction({ transactionId }: { transactionId: string }) {
const transaction = this.transactions.get(transactionId);
if (!transaction) {
throw new Error(`Transaction with ID ${transactionId} not found.`);
}
await transaction.rollback();
this.transactions.delete(transactionId);
return this.toResult(`Transaction with ID ${transactionId} rolled back successfully.`);
}
}
